Wells Fargo Championship Golf Tips: Chris Di Marco

chris dimarco

Led the field in putts at the Zurich Classic confirming signs of a revival.

It is more of the same this week as we stick with comeback kid Chris DiMarco. After topping the putting stats at Louisiana, confidence is returning to his game, just witness his closing round of 68. A finish of 26th could have been even better if it wasn’t for a sticky conclusion to Saturday where he dropped five shots in three holes.

Despite struggling for distance off the tee, DiMarco is a straight hitter, ranking 27th in driving accuracy. This means he should not be too disadvantaged when up against the bombers.

His course form is also reasonable, if we go back to 2005 he has a fourth place to his name and a T18 in 2003. Recent years have not been kind to him, but that was a period when he was struggling at every golf course.

Despite strong showings in the last fortnight DiMarco is ignored by the bookmakers at 225/1. A price far too big for a man who has broken 70 in five of his last seven rounds.
